Walking Through History: The Sacred Legacy of Porbandar

To visit Porbandar is to take a step back in time. The very air here seems to hum with stories from centuries past. Long before it became famous as Bapu's birthplace, this city was a bustling port during the Harappan civilization, connecting ancient India to the world.

Of course, the heart of Porbandar's history lies in Kirti Mandir. This isn't just a structure of brick and mortar; it’s the ancestral home where Mohandas Karamchand Gandhi was born. Standing there, you can almost feel the presence of the great soul who walked these very floors. The building itself is a beautiful blend of traditional Gujarati architecture and modern design, a fitting tribute to a man who bridged eras. It’s a moment of quiet reflection, a feeling of deep connection to our nation's journey.

Just a short distance away, you'll find the serene Sudama Mandir. This temple is dedicated to the beautiful, selfless friendship between Lord Krishna and Sudama. It reminds us that faith and friendship are two of the most powerful bonds in the universe. The spiritual energy here is palpable, offering a sense of peace that stays with you long after you've left. The city also houses the Bharat Mandir, a treasure trove of Hindu mythology depicted through intricate sculptures and art.

Must-Visit Places in Porbandar for 2025

Beyond its deep historical roots, Porbandar offers a wonderful mix of natural beauty and architectural marvels. Here’s what you shouldn't miss on your trip:

  • Chowpatty Beach: After a day of exploring, there’s nothing quite like watching the sunset at Porbandar’s Chowpatty Beach. The gentle sea breeze, the sound of the waves, and the sky painted in hues of orange and pink create a truly magical atmosphere. It's the perfect place to unwind, reflect, and just be in the moment.
  • Huzoor Palace: This stunning palace, with its European-style architecture, offers a glimpse into the royal past of Porbandar. Facing the sea, it stands as a grand testament to the city's regal history. While entry inside might be restricted, its majestic facade is a sight to behold and a favorite for photographers.
  • Porbandar Bird Sanctuary: For nature lovers, this sanctuary is a hidden gem right in the heart of the city. During the winter months, it becomes a temporary home for countless migratory birds. The symphony of chirps and the sight of colourful wings fluttering about is a refreshing and joyous experience.
  • Barda Hills Wildlife Sanctuary: If you're up for a short drive, the Barda Hills Wildlife Sanctuary offers a richer dive into Gujarat's biodiversity. It's a fantastic place for a small trek and to connect with nature away from the city's hustle and bustle.

Experience the Soul of Porbandar: Culture, Food, and Festivities

Porbandar’s culture is as vibrant as its history. The city comes alive during festivals like Navratri, where the air fills with the beats of dandiya and the joyful energy of Garba. Janmashtami is another festival celebrated with immense devotion, honouring the birth of Lord Krishna.

A journey to Porbandar is incomplete without indulging in its delicious food. You must try an authentic Gujarati thali, a platter full of flavours that includes everything from dhokla and khandvi to various vegetable preparations and sweets. The local markets are a treasure trove for shoppers, where you can find beautiful Bandhani sarees, handcrafted textiles, and unique souvenirs made from seashells.

Planning Your Porbandar Trip: Practical Information

Making your way to Porbandar is quite straightforward. The city is well-connected through its own airport, a railway station, and an excellent network of roads from major cities like Ahmedabad and Rajkot. So, whether you prefer to fly, take a train, or enjoy a road trip, reaching this coastal gem is easy.

Thinking about the best time to visit Porbandar? The ideal months are from October to March. During this period, the weather is cool and pleasant, making it perfect for sightseeing and exploring the city on foot. Summers can get quite hot, so it's best to avoid planning your trip then.

As for your stay, Porbandar offers a variety of accommodation options. From budget-friendly guesthouses to comfortable hotels, you'll find a place that suits your needs.
